Dermot O’Leary was so excited to give some cash away on the latest helping of This Morning, he nearly bankrupted the show.

Appearing in the popular ITV magazine show alongside his usual co-host Alison Hammond, the presenter, 48, was hosting the Dosh on the Doorstep segment – but accidentally offered a touch too much dosh.

Watch the video below.

Speaking via video link to Josie Gibson, Dermot was looking to unveil the next winner of Dosh on the Doorstep: a game which sees Josie give viewers a cash prize by turning up at their house.

Returning to Josie, Dermot announced: “We're hoping that she's gonna walk away with £10,000 today in today's game of Dosh on your Doorstep!”

However, Alison was quick to step in to correct her co-presenter’s error.

“No! It's only £1,000 today, it's not £10,000! You're giving away too much money!" she said, interrupting Dermot as he misspoke.

Laughing off his faux-pas, Dermot joked: “I said £10,000! Well, we're all hoping that!”

Quick to egg Dermot on, Josie chuckled: “You’ve said it, you’ve said it now, Dermot!”

Easily done, Dermot!

Alison and Dermot are at the helm of This Morning this week; while they usually only host the Friday morning edition of the show, they’ve taken over from usual presenters Philip Schofield and Holly Willoughby, so the pair can enjoy an extra long Christmas break.

A and D have proven popular on the programme, however, and have been at the heart of several hilarious viral moments.

More recently, viewers at home were left in hysterics when the duo interviewed comedy legend Barry Humphries (better know as Dame Edna).

Dermot and Alison are popular on the programme (
ITV)

Mid-interview, Barry stopped to congratulate Dermot on his “courage to come out” – pretending to mistake him for Schofe.

“I think a lot of people respected you for that,” Barry said, as Alison cackled in the background.
